SJ51 EHL is a 2002 Piaggio Px 200 E in Silver with a 123c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90.9%.

Across all 2002 Piaggio Px 200 E models, the average MOT pass rate is 88.7% with a typical mileage of 14,026 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Piaggio Px 200 E fails its MOT is tyre tread depth is below minimum requirements of 1.0mm, accounting for 225 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SJ51 EHL,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Piaggio Px 200 E typ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 24 years old, this Piaggio Px 200 E is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
